  1. Potential impacts of a green revolution in Africa: The case of Ghana por Breisinger, Clemens, Diao, Xinshen, Thurlow, James, Al-Hassan, Ramatu M.

    Publicado 2011
    “…Given the huge public investments required, this paper aims to assess the potential impacts of a green revolution. Results from a CGE model for Ghana show that green revolution type growth is strongly pro‐poor and provides substantial transfers to the rest of the economy, thus providing a powerful argument to raise public expenditure on agriculture to make a green revolution happen in Africa. …”

  10. Evaluating transfer programs within a general equilibrium framework por Coady, David, Harris, Rebecca Lee

    Publicado 2001
    “…The authors set out a general equilibrium model for the evaluation of a domestically financed transfer program, which helps to combine the results from a computable general equilibrium model with disaggregated household data.Using a Mexican cash transfer program as an illustration, they use the approach to show that the substantial welfare gains that result from the switch from universal food subsidies to targeted cash transfers reflect both the improved targeting efficiency of the latter as well as a relaxation of the trade-off between equity and efficiency objectives when designing tax systems.…”
